Event Description

The Bay Area Bomba y Plena Workshop invites you to remember and celebrate life and growth that results from loss and suffering. Through death and loss comes rebirth and strengthening.

Join us in remembering & celebrating by participating in our COMMUNITY ALTAR. This installation will represent, in an authentic and intentional way, the suffering, loss, and renewal of life that Puerto Rico and its people have and are experiencing as a result of hurricane Maria. We encourage you to bring pictures or object to add to the community altar!

Come hungry so we can enjoy a COMMUNITY MEAL with Puerto Rican cuisine by Cali-Rican catering. Menu coming soon! (Food not included with Ticket.)

Bring your dancing shoes, because DJ JOSE RUIZ will be throwing down his incredible collection of tropical music!

Plus, the Bay Area Bomba y Plena Workshop invites you to participate in a special BATEY BORICUA COMMUNITY BOMBAZO (BOMB & PLENA JAM). So bring your faldas, barriles, panderos, voice and positive vibes to join us in a community jam. Or just come enjoy the music and dance!

Doors open at 4:30pm
$10 Advance / $15 Door / $5 Kids under 12
